logo

Output 38eea4fe0d4a5cd234d468c2369da591634fd7757a6277e4e9f5c3a53ffbc9a5:21

value
750000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89576543c78cc2fc4d61acedc28f816bff0da6ed OP_EQUAL
address
3EDDCB6WDEjSDyb9rW2gRGsRoK7xiS4fSq
transaction
38eea4fe0d4a5cd234d468c2369da591634fd7757a6277e4e9f5c3a53ffbc9a5